SENATE RESOLUTION NO. 530
|
|
WHEREAS, Many proud citizens of Lamar County are visiting |
|
the State Capitol on March 27, 2013, to celebrate the prominent |
|
role this Northeast Texas county has played in the annals of the |
|
Lone Star State; and |
|
|
WHEREAS, At the time of the Republic of Texas, present-day |
|
Lamar County was located within the boundaries of Red River |
|
County; population growth led the Fifth Congress of the republic |
|
to establish Lamar County on December 17, 1840, and the current |
|
boundaries were drawn 30 years later when a portion of land was |
|
carved out for the creation of Delta County; and |
|
|
WHEREAS, Lamar County's namesake was the fourth president |
|
of the Republic of Texas, Mirabeau B. Lamar; the small settlement |
|
of Lafayette served as the first county seat, but after the Texas |
|
Congress passed a law requiring that each county seat be located |
|
within five miles of the county's geographic center, Mount Vernon |
|
served briefly in that capacity until the town of Paris was |
|
founded on 50 acres donated by George W. Wright; Paris has served |
|
as the county seat since 1844; and |
|
|
WHEREAS, Numerous early settlers migrated to Lamar County |
|
through Tennessee and Kentucky and established small farms; at |
|
the turn of the century, the county remained primarily rural, and |
|
although the population of Paris had grown to more than 9,000, no |
|
other community exceeded 1,000 residents; the industrial economy |
|
gradually began to make gains on agriculture in the 20th century |
|
as people moved into towns and smaller communities, and Paris |
|
played an increasingly important role in the economy of Northeast |
|
Texas; and |

WHEREAS, Today, Paris is a regional hub for retail trade, |
|
farming, and medical care and home to three Fortune 500 |
|
companies, Campbell Soup Company, Kimberly-Clark Corporation, |
|
and Florida Power and Light; the city's newest major employer is |
|
James Skinner Baking Company; Paris is located within an |
|
excellent multimodal transportation network, and in addition to |
|
numerous food and consumer goods manufacturing plants, it is home |
|
to distribution centers that serve the entire nation; and |
|
|
WHEREAS, Quality of life in Paris is enhanced by Paris |
|
Junior College and several excellent independent school |
|
districts offering school choice; beautiful local recreation |
|
areas include Wade Park, Lake Gibbons, Lake Crook, and the Sam |
|
Bell Maxey House State Historic Site; every summer, citizens |
|
enjoy the Tour de Paris bicycle race along the 12-mile Trail de |
|
Paris and concerts by the Paris Municipal Band, the oldest such |
|
ensemble in the state; landmarks include the Culbertson Fountain |
|
in the historic district, named "the prettiest plaza in the State |
|
of Texas" by Texas Monthly magazine, and the "third largest |
|
Eiffel Tower in the second largest Paris," a 65-foot-tall |
|
monument constructed by local workers and capped, appropriately, |
|
with a red cowboy hat; and |
